- /**
- * Builds a SELECT query with multiple conditions and fields.
- *
- * The query uses both 'locales_source' and 'locales_target' tables.
- * Note that by default, as we are selecting both translated and untranslated
- * strings target field's conditions will be modified to match NULL rows too.
- *
- * @param array $conditions
- * An associative array with field => value conditions that may include
- * NULL values. If a language condition is included it will be used for
- * joining the 'locales_target' table.
- * @param array $options
- * An associative array of additional options. It may contain any of the
- * options used by StringStorageInterface::getStrings() and these additional
- * ones:
- * - 'translation', Whether to include translation fields too. Defaults to
- * FALSE.
- * @return SelectQuery
- * Query object with all the tables, fields and conditions.
- */
- protected function dbStringSelect(array $conditions, array $options = array()) {
- // Change field 'customized' into 'l10n_status'. This enables the Drupal 8
- // backported code to work with the Drupal 7 style database tables.
- if (isset($conditions['customized'])) {
- $conditions['l10n_status'] = $conditions['customized'];
- unset($conditions['customized']);
- }
- if (isset($options['customized'])) {
- $options['l10n_status'] = $options['customized'];
- unset($options['customized']);
- }
- // Start building the query with source table and check whether we need to
- // join the target table too.
- $query = db_select('locales_source', 's', $this->options)
- ->fields('s');
- // Figure out how to join and translate some options into conditions.
- if (isset($conditions['translated'])) {
- // This is a meta-condition we need to translate into simple ones.
- if ($conditions['translated']) {
- // Select only translated strings.
- $join = 'innerJoin';
- }
- else {
- // Select only untranslated strings.
- $join = 'leftJoin';
- $conditions['translation'] = NULL;
- }
- unset($conditions['translated']);
- }
- else {
- $join = !empty($options['translation']) ? 'leftJoin' : FALSE;
- }
- if ($join) {
- if (isset($conditions['language'])) {
- // If we've got a language condition, we use it for the join.
- $query->$join('locales_target', 't', "t.lid = s.lid AND t.language = :langcode", array(
- ':langcode' => $conditions['language']
- ));
- unset($conditions['language']);
- }
- else {
- // Since we don't have a language, join with locale id only.
- $query->$join('locales_target', 't', "t.lid = s.lid");
- }
- if (!empty($options['translation'])) {
- // We cannot just add all fields because 'lid' may get null values.
- $query->addField('t', 'language');
- $query->addField('t', 'translation');
- $query->addField('t', 'l10n_status', 'customized');
- }
- }
- // If we have conditions for location's type or name, then we need the
- // location table, for which we add a subquery.
- if (isset($conditions['type']) || isset($conditions['name'])) {
- $subquery = db_select('locales_location', 'l', $this->options)
- ->fields('l', array('sid'));
- foreach (array('type', 'name') as $field) {
- if (isset($conditions[$field])) {
- $subquery->condition('l.' . $field, $conditions[$field]);
- unset($conditions[$field]);
- }
- }
- $query->condition('s.lid', $subquery, 'IN');
- }
- // Add conditions for both tables.
- foreach ($conditions as $field => $value) {
- $table_alias = $this->dbFieldTable($field);
- $field_alias = $table_alias . '.' . $field;
- if (is_null($value)) {
- $query->isNull($field_alias);
- }
- elseif ($table_alias == 't' && $join === 'leftJoin') {
- // Conditions for target fields when doing an outer join only make
- // sense if we add also OR field IS NULL.
- $query->condition(db_or()
- ->condition($field_alias, $value)
- ->isNull($field_alias)
- );
- }
- else {
- $query->condition($field_alias, $value);
- }
- }
- // Process other options, string filter, query limit, etc...
- if (!empty($options['filters'])) {
- if (count($options['filters']) > 1) {
- $filter = db_or();
- $query->condition($filter);
- }
- else {
- // If we have a single filter, just add it to the query.
- $filter = $query;
- }
- foreach ($options['filters'] as $field => $string) {
- $filter->condition($this->dbFieldTable($field) . '.' . $field, '%' . db_like($string) . '%', 'LIKE');
- }
- }
- if (!empty($options['pager limit'])) {
- $query = $query->extend('PagerDefault')->limit($options['pager limit']);
- }
- return $query;
- }
